NetBSD-Bugs arch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

Re: port-cobalt/38391: Recently imported OpenSSH 5.0 crashes cobalt kernel via its sshd binary



The following reply was made to PR port-cobalt/38391; it has been noted by 
GNATS.

From: christos%zoulas.com@localhost (Christos Zoulas)
To: Izumi Tsutsui <tsutsui%ceres.dti.ne.jp@localhost>
Cc: nick.hudson%dsl.pipex.com@localhost, gnats-bugs%NetBSD.org@localhost, 
        port-cobalt-maintainer%NetBSD.org@localhost, 
gnats-admin%NetBSD.org@localhost, 
        netbsd-bugs%NetBSD.org@localhost
Subject: Re: port-cobalt/38391: Recently imported OpenSSH 5.0 crashes cobalt 
kernel via its sshd binary
Date: Tue, 15 Apr 2008 13:15:24 -0400

 On Apr 16, 12:41am, tsutsui%ceres.dti.ne.jp@localhost (Izumi Tsutsui) wrote:
 -- Subject: Re: port-cobalt/38391: Recently imported OpenSSH 5.0 crashes coba
 
 | christos%zoulas.com@localhost wrote:
 | 
 | > I think it is file descriptor stuff. Try a Feb-15 kernel.
 | 
 | On RaQ1, with userland fetched from NetBSD-daily/HEAD/200804080000Z,
 | today's (2008/04/15 ~14:40 UTC) kernel:
 | ---
 | Enter passphrase for key '/home/tsutsui/.ssh/id_rsa': 
 | trap: address error (load or I-fetch) in kernel mode
 | status=0xfc03, cause=0x10, epc=0x8028f7fc, vaddr=0x23
 | pid=596 cmd=sshd usp=0x7fffcdc0 ksp=0xc6889c88
 | Stopped in pid 596.1 (sshd) at  netbsd:mutex_enter:     ll      t0,a0,0
 | db> tr
 | mutex_enter+0 (23,802403f0,1,0) ra 80240418 sz 0
 | unp_discard+28 (23,802403f0,1,0) ra 802405f0 sz 32
 | unp_scan+ec (23,802403f0,1,0) ra 80242498 sz 48
 | uipc_usrreq+210 (23,802403f0,1,0) ra 8023b7cc sz 56
 | sosend+4b8 (82daf138,0,c6889e18,83a76e00) ra 8023f3ec sz 88
 | do_sys_sendmsg+344 (82daf138,0,c6889e18,83a76e00) ra 8023f534 sz 192
 | sys_sendmsg+5c (82daf138,0,c6889e18,83a76e00) ra 80294d50 sz 80
 | syscall_plain+130 (82daf138,0,c6889e18,83a76e00) ra 8028e8fc sz 80
 | mips3_SystemCall+bc (82daf138,0,c6889e18,83a76e00) ra 7d72caf0 sz 0
 | PC 0x7d72caf0: not in kernel space
 | 0+7d72caf0 (82daf138,0,c6889e18,83a76e00) ra 0 sz 0
 | User-level: pid 596.1
 | db> 
 | ---
 | 
 | 2008/03/21 00:00:00 UTC kernel:
 | ---
 | Enter passphrase for key '/home/tsutsui/.ssh/id_rsa': 
 | trap: address error (load or I-fetch) in kernel mode
 | status=0xfc03, cause=0x10, epc=0x8028c03c, vaddr=0x3b
 | pid=563 cmd=sshd usp=0x7fffcdc0 ksp=0xc687bc80
 | Stopped in pid 563.1 (sshd) at  netbsd:mutex_enter:     ll      t0,a0,0
 | db> tr
 | mutex_enter+0 (3b,8023c4f0,1,0) ra 8023c518 sz 0
 | unp_discard+28 (3b,8023c4f0,1,0) ra 8023c71c sz 32
 | unp_scan+ec (3b,8023c4f0,1,0) ra 8023e6d4 sz 48
 | uipc_usrreq+248 (3b,8023c4f0,1,0) ra 80236dd8 sz 56
 | sosend+4c8 (82610dc8,0,c687be18,83a8be00) ra 8023b09c sz 96
 | do_sys_sendmsg+350 (82610dc8,0,c687be18,83a8be00) ra 8023b22c sz 192
 | sys_sendmsg+5c (82610dc8,0,c687be18,83a8be00) ra 80291590 sz 80
 | syscall_plain+130 (82610dc8,0,c687be18,83a8be00) ra 8028b13c sz 80
 | mips3_SystemCall+bc (82610dc8,0,c687be18,83a8be00) ra 7d72caf0 sz 0
 | PC 0x7d72caf0: not in kernel space
 | 0+7d72caf0 (82610dc8,0,c687be18,83a8be00) ra 0 sz 0
 | User-level: pid 563.1
 | db> 
 | 
 | 2008/02/15 00:00:00 UTC kernel:
 | ---
 | Enter passphrase for key '/home/tsutsui/.ssh/id_rsa': 
 | trap: address error (load or I-fetch) in kernel mode
 | status=0xfc03, cause=0x10, epc=0x8028ab8c, vaddr=0x3b
 | pid=596 cmd=sshd usp=0x7fffcdc0 ksp=0xc687bc80
 | Stopped in pid 596.1 (sshd) at  netbsd:mutex_enter:     ll      t0,a0,0
 | db> tr
 | mutex_enter+0 (3b,8023b0c0,1,0) ra 8023b0e8 sz 0
 | unp_discard+28 (3b,8023b0c0,1,0) ra 8023b2ec sz 32
 | unp_scan+ec (3b,8023b0c0,1,0) ra 8023d2a4 sz 48
 | uipc_usrreq+248 (3b,8023b0c0,1,0) ra 802359d4 sz 56
 | sosend+4c8 (82609dc8,0,c687be18,83a8c500) ra 80239c6c sz 96
 | do_sys_sendmsg+350 (82609dc8,0,c687be18,83a8c500) ra 80239dfc sz 192
 | sys_sendmsg+5c (82609dc8,0,c687be18,83a8c500) ra 802900e0 sz 80
 | syscall_plain+130 (82609dc8,0,c687be18,83a8c500) ra 80289c8c sz 80
 | mips3_SystemCall+bc (82609dc8,0,c687be18,83a8c500) ra 7d72caf0 sz 0
 | PC 0x7d72caf0: not in kernel space
 | 0+7d72caf0 (82609dc8,0,c687be18,83a8c500) ra 0 sz 0
 | User-level: pid 596.1
 | db> 
 | ---
 | 
 | 2008/01/01 00:00:00 UTC kernel:
 | ---
 | Enter passphrase for key '/home/tsutsui/.ssh/id_rsa': 
 | trap: address error (load or I-fetch) in kernel mode
 | status=0xfc03, cause=0x10, epc=0x802852ac, vaddr=0x43
 | pid=563 cmd=sshd usp=0x7fffbdc0 ksp=0xc6865c80
 | Stopped in pid 563.1 (sshd) at  netbsd:mutex_enter:     ll      t0,a0,0
 | db> tr
 | mutex_enter+0 (43,80236b10,1,0) ra 80236b38 sz 0
 | unp_discard+28 (43,80236b10,1,0) ra 80236d3c sz 32
 | unp_scan+ec (43,80236b10,1,0) ra 80238d10 sz 48
 | uipc_usrreq+248 (43,80236b10,1,0) ra 80231254 sz 56
 | sosend+4c4 (82c24388,0,c6865e18,83a9a300) ra 802356bc sz 96
 | do_sys_sendmsg+350 (82c24388,0,c6865e18,83a9a300) ra 8023584c sz 192
 | sys_sendmsg+5c (82c24388,0,c6865e18,83a9a300) ra 8028a800 sz 80
 | syscall_plain+130 (82c24388,0,c6865e18,83a9a300) ra 802843ac sz 80
 | mips3_SystemCall+bc (82c24388,0,c6865e18,83a9a300) ra 7d72caf0 sz 0
 | PC 0x7d72caf0: not in kernel space
 | 0+7d72caf0 (82c24388,0,c6865e18,83a9a300) ra 0 sz 0
 | User-level: pid 563.1
 | db> 
 | ---
 | 
 | Hmm...
 
 Andy committed some fixes for unp_discard...
 
 christos
 


Home | Main Index | Thread Index | Old Index